Wall Inspection and Repair



Examining wall surfaces for any kind of blemishes and promptly addressing them via essential repair services is crucial for accomplishing a smooth and perfect paint work. Prior to beginning the painting procedure, thoroughly check out the walls for splits, holes, damages, or any other damage that can impact the final result.

Beginning by completing any kind of cracks or holes with spackling substance, permitting it to completely dry entirely before sanding it down to develop a smooth surface. For larger dents or harmed areas, think about utilizing joint compound to guarantee a smooth repair service.

Additionally, look for any kind of loosened paint or wallpaper that may need to be eliminated. Remove any kind of pe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to develop a consistent texture.

It's also vital to examine for water damages, as this can bring about mold and mildew growth and influence the adhesion of the brand-new paint. Deal with any type of water stains or mold with the proper cleansing solutions before waging the paint process.

Cleansing and Surface Prep Work



To guarantee an immaculate and well-prepared surface area for painting, the following action entails thoroughly cleaning up and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ber cloth or a duster to get rid of any kind of loosened dust, cobwebs, or particles.

For even more stubborn dust or grime, a remedy of moderate detergent and water can be used to delicately scrub the walls, complied with by a detailed rinse with tidy water. Pay special interest to areas near light switches, door deals with, and baseboards, as these have a tendency to gather more dust.

After cleaning, it is essential to evaluate the walls for any fractures, holes, or flaws. These must be filled with spackling substance and sanded smooth once completely dry. Sanding the wall surfaces gently with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ly likewise assist develop an uniform surface area for painting.
